Speaking Exercise 1: Multiple Choice
Take Quiz
Check your understanding here ...
Speaking Exercise 2: Gap Filling
[qsm quiz=87]
Speaking Exercise 3: Gap Filling
[qsm quiz=88]
Comments
Take Quiz
Check your understanding here ...
[qsm quiz=87]
[qsm quiz=88]